Yoshihisa Tsurunari is a researcher dedicated to advancing coastal environmental conservation through innovative underwater monitoring technologies. His work focuses on developing accessible, low-cost methods for observing shallow water ecosystems, addressing the challenges posed by turbid waters, waves, and currents that make traditional diver-based monitoring difficult. His most notable contribution is the development of a simple underwater monitoring system using a spherical camera mounted on a radio-controlled boat, which enables efficient observation of shallow coastal environments without requiring specialized diving teams. This approach, detailed in his 2016 paper, has garnered attention for its practicality and potential to democratize coastal research.
